Name: Marr Vell

Race: Norterner

Class: Dragoon

Age: 22

Description:White hair, purple eyes, 5' 11", 150 lbs.

History:Marr Vell was raised by his kind and loving foster parents, in the rural village of Edgeville. He knew his whole life that he was adopted, with only faint memories of his homeland. Memories of crashing waves, and a haven of birds.After his foster parents both passed away, Marr felt that he no longer held any ties to edgeville. So he left to travel the world in search of his birth home.During his travels he was attacked by thieves. His years of working with his father had taught him little of combat, his strength was more than a match for the first few, but he was quickly overwelmed. As the brigands were about to finish him, a wandering Dragoon came to his rescue. The Dragoon easily smote down all the thieves with the broad side of his sword. After being helped up by the Dragoon, Marr asked, "Why did you spare them? They were villains, you should have killed them, they will only commit more acts of violance."To which the Dragoon replied, "It is not mine or your place to decide their fates. But now they see the consequences of their actions, perhaps they will think twice before trying to attack a defenseless traveler."This inspired Marr Vell, who begged the Dragoon to teach him to be a Dragoon himself. The dragoon was apreahensive at first, but upon looking into Marr's eyes the Dragoon decided to take him in.The years of training were harsh on Marr, but with an amazing amount of determination, he perservered. After five years of difficult training Marr surpassed even the Dragoon's long trained skills.Later that year the Dragoon left. "Marr," he said, "you've grown beyond even my expectations, you've earned this." Upon saying these words, the Dragoon handed Marr a sword. Marr recognized the sword instantly, it was the very sword the Dragoon used to save him all those years ago. "Take it, it's yours now." With that the Dragoon left for parts unknown.Afterwards, Marr wandered the country side, doing the very deeds that the Dragoon had done for him. But still his life lacked purpose. Until one day, he met a young druidess named Kalinka Blue. After rescuing her from a group of goblins the two became fast friends. Though a little goofy at times, Marr really felt comfortable in Kalinka's company.Months later, Marr and Kalinka came across the Berserker Joneus Gold, he needed strong warriors to aid him and his grey knights in a war against chaos. Marr was never one to turn his back on those in need, so he signed up unquestionably, quickly making friends with joneus and his fellows in the process.Not long afterwards, in a sparring match with joneus, Marr learned a little of his own unknown heritage as a northerner. Like Joneus, Marr had the ability to shape-shift. The animal Marr chose was a hawk, which he saw as an appropriate avatar for his lost past.Now, Marr Vell, is a reknowned Dragoon. Best known for swooping in to rescue anyone who needs rescuing, and leaving without even asking for a reward.
